Ibanez Acoustic Bridge is Lifting

Hey hey! Here we have an Ibanez Artwood AC30 acoustic guitar, not to be confused with the famous Vox AC30 amp! The bridge is separating from the guitar top. I am just gonna upload a bunch of photos so here’s what I did to follow along!

Anyway, the course of action in this situation is to remove the bridge, prep the surface, and reglue it. I heated up the glue joint with my iron, being careful to protect the finish, and carefully loosened the glue with a putty knife.

The bridge had been lifting for quite a while I suspect, so it was really warped. I clamped it down flat while it was still hot. There was a lot of extra finish under where the bridge was so I removed that. After the bridge was clamped flat I removed any extra glue and sanded it so it sat flat on the guitar top. Then I glued and clamped and did some final cleanup and presentation.
